Prof. Dr. Georg Christoph Feigl is a Germany-based academic researcher at Universität Witten/Herdecke, specializing in clinical anatomy, surgical education, anesthesiology-related anatomy, and cadaver-based medical training. He has authored over 120 peer-reviewed publications, accumulating 2,419 citations with an h-index of 25, reflecting sustained international impact. His research focuses on anatomical optimization for surgical and interventional procedures, including regional anesthesia, orthopedic and thoracic surgery, and advanced cadaveric models (Thiel and Dodge embalming techniques). Prof. Feigl collaborates widely across disciplines, with 300+ co-authors, contributing to translational studies that bridge anatomy, imaging, and clinical practice. His work supports safer surgical techniques, improved medical training, and evidence-based procedural standards, delivering clear societal benefits through enhanced patient safety, education quality, and clinical outcomes.

Tana Takacova is a physician-scientist specializing in hematology, oncology, and internal medicine with a distinguished academic and clinical trajectory across leading European research and tertiary care institutions. Her expertise spans immuno-oncology, molecular oncology, hematologic malignancies, and translational cancer research, supported by advanced training in oncology from a major German university and extensive postgraduate exposure to molecular biosciences in the United States. She has held clinical roles in prominent university-affiliated hospitals, progressing through multidisciplinary departments including hematology, oncology, palliative medicine, internal medicine, rheumatology, nephrology, gastroenterology, and cardiology, complemented by ongoing training as a prehospital emergency physician. Dr. Takacova has contributed to multiple international research collaborations across Germany, Denmark, Italy, and Slovakia, advancing knowledge in cancer genetics, circulating tumor DNA, oncolytic virus-checkpoint inhibitor synergies, renal cell carcinoma biomarkers, and therapy response prediction. Her peer-reviewed scholarship includes original research articles, systematic reviews, and case-based contributions in oncology and immunology, with additional manuscripts in review and development, reflecting a sustained commitment to evidence-based innovation and emerging therapeutic paradigms in precision oncology. She has presented at international oncology and pharmacology congresses and participates in global research networks and professional societies, reinforcing a truly international academic presence. Her work integrates advanced laboratory skills, clinical trial supervision, systematic review methodology, and bioinformatics-supported analysis, underscoring strong translational orientation. She has been recognized by competitive research fellowships and academic awards and contributes to open-access medical knowledge through educational initiatives such as a freely accessible hematology atlas. Fluent in multiple languages and trained across diverse health systems, she brings a global perspective, resilience in high-pressure environments, and a collaborative approach to clinical care and research leadership, driven by a commitment to advancing cancer diagnostics, therapeutic precision, and equitable patient outcomes worldwide. She has 34 citations from 4 documents with an h-index of 2.
